Diagnostic Procedure

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2005 Nissan 350Z.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. CHECK GROUND CONNECTIONS 
    1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
    2. Loosen and retighten three ground screws on the body. Refer to "GROUND INSPECTION ".
      Fig 1: Loosen & Retighten Three Ground Screws On The Body
      G02402052Courtesy of NISSAN MOTOR CO., U.S.A.

    OK or NG

    • OK: GO TO 2.
    • NG: Repair or replace ground connections.
  2. CHECK ASCD STEERING SWITCH CIRCUIT 

    With CONSULT-II 

    1. Turn ignition switch ON.
    2. Select "MAIN SW", "RESUME/ACC SW", "SET SW" and "CANCEL SW" in "DATA MONITOR" mode with CONSULT-II.
    3. Check each item indication under the following conditions.
      Fig 2: Switch Condition Specification Table
      G02402053Courtesy of NISSAN MOTOR CO., U.S.A.
      Fig 3: Scan Tool Display "Data Monitor"
      G02402054Courtesy of NISSAN MOTOR CO., U.S.A.

    Without CONSULT-II 

    1. Turn ignition switch ON.
    2. Check voltage between ECM terminal 99 and ground with pressing each button.
      Fig 4: Switch Condition Voltage Specification Table
      G02402055Courtesy of NISSAN MOTOR CO., U.S.A.
      Fig 5: ECM Connector Terminal 99 & Ground Voltage Test
      G02402056Courtesy of NISSAN MOTOR CO., U.S.A.

    OK or NG

    • OK: GO TO  8.
    • NG: GO TO 3.
  3. CHECK ASCD STEERING SWITCH GROUND C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T 
    1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
    2. Disconnect ECM harness connector.
    3. Disconnect combination switch harness connector M203.
    4. Check harness continuity between combination switch terminal 15 and ECM terminal 67. Refer to WIRING DIAGRAM .
      • Continuity should exist. 
    5. Also check harness for short to ground and short to power.

    OK or NG

    • OK: GO TO  5.
    • NG: GO TO 4.
  4. DETECT MALFUNCTIONING PART 

    Check the following.

    • Harness connectors M72, F102
    • Combination switch (spiral cable)
    • Harness for open and short between ECM and combination switch
      • : Repair open circuit or short to 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
  5. CHECK ASCD STEERING SWITCH INPUT SIGNAL C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T 
    1. Check harness continuity between ECM terminal 99 and combination switch terminal 14. Refer to WIRING DIAGRAM .
      • Continuity should exist. 
    2. Also check harness for short to ground and short to power.

    OK or NG

    • OK: GO TO  7.
    • NG: GO TO 6.
  6. DETECT MALFUNCTIONING PART 

    Check the following.

    • Harness connectors M72, F102
    • Combination switch (spiral cable)
    • Harness for open and short between ECM and combination switch
      • : Repair open circuit or short to 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
  7. CHECK ASCD STEERING SWITCH 

    Refer to "COMPONENT INSPECTION ".

    OK or NG

    • OK: GO TO 8.
    • NG: Replace steering wheel.
  8. CHECK INTERMITTENT INCIDENT 

    Refer to "TROUBLE DIAGNOSIS FOR INTERMITTENT INCIDENT ".

    • : INSPECTION END
